Output e424de36b5d72f93b9b302add3bd48eaa201ce810877595fdf1570ac3b838e57:25

value
2800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e07a2c1e46cc2eab437f022e0b74925fcd58c1 OP_EQUAL
address
39hfdBfpKhKWiPiPChgfcHkTGGVk7FyYfr
transaction
e424de36b5d72f93b9b302add3bd48eaa201ce810877595fdf1570ac3b838e57
spent
true